Description General Summary A Quality Engineer position is currently available at our facility in Galion, OH. This is a full-time salaried position with benefit eligibility. Primarily responsible for support and coordination as well as implementation of PPAP’s and FAAT's assuring alignment with our quality programs and systems. The Quality Engineer leads the consistent application of PPAP’s and ensures they conform to customer requirements. The quality engineer works under direct supervision of the Quality Manager, performing routine but somewhat varied duties in accordance with standard procedures. The Quality Engineer work may require limited independent judgement and knowledge of related operations. Duties and Responsibilities Analysis and Execution Responsible to utilize problem solving techniques, team building strategies, process control and continuous process improvement tools to meet or exceed the key performance indicators and Statistical Process Control (SPC) requirements. Hands-on practitioner of Lean and Continuous Improvement; utilize lean tools (i.e. brainstorming, fishbone analysis, Pareto, value stream mapping, 5S, FMEA, five “whys”) to reduce variability. Responsible to analyze manufacturing site methods and operations, develops improvement plans, and recommend and/or implement change and eliminate non-conforming products. Responsible to conduct presentations and informational meetings for all levels of manufacturing population regarding productivity and improvement changes or standards. Review, prepare and submit PPAP’s and FAAT's. Manage APQP activities (drawing reviews, control plans, Gage R&R, capability studies, etc.). Participation in technical reviews. Directs sampling inspection and testing of PPAP parts, components, and materials to determine conformance to standards and customer requirements. Responsible for operation of computer hardware and software related to PPAP and FAAT data collection and determination of product quality and process capability. Interface with both customer and vendors as required in such areas as: PPAP, APQP, Process Control Plans, FEMA’s, MSA and SPC, etc. Needs to support timely and comprehensive reporting of PPAP and FAAT status to customers and management. Management project skills are a must and the ability to manage several projects/tasks that are going on simultaneously. Ability to use project management software, Microsoft Project or equivalent.
